Toyota Unveils i-Road Concept Vehicle, An Electric Commuter Tricycle

Toyota has unveiled a new concept vehicle, called i-Road. It is essentially an electric tricycle which is meant for commuting in the neighborhood.

The Geneva Motor Show is just around the corner, where all major vehicle vendors will be showing off their upcoming offerings. Toyota, apparently, has plans of showing off i-Road, a new concept vehicle which is essentially an electric tricycle and seems something straight out of the Tron movie.


Toyota i-Road

Toyota i-Road is something of a hybrid between a motor bike and a small car. It has two wheels in the front which can, interestingly, lean either ways when needed. There’s another rear wheel. It may seem impractical but given the fact that Toyota is positioning it to be an urban vehicle for 30-miles drives at maximum, that makes the concept seem fairly plausible.

The highest speed that i-Road can muster is 30 mph and upon a single recharge, it can go on for 30 miles on end. Both these specifications reveal that this vehicle is meant to be used as a commuter-ride within the neighborhood.

i-Road

As far as the looks are concerned, i-Road is certainly very stylish. It is 2.35 meters long, a mere 850mm wide and 1.4 meters tall. The weight is also fairly low at 660 lbs. The power for the car is generated with the help of two electric powers installed within, each of which can produce 27 horsepower units.

In all, the concept is fairly novel and Toyota may be able to pitch it well enough in the urban cities. We look forward to hearing more details about the i-Road vehicle at the Geneva Motor Show.
